UK Poverty facts

Nearly 13 million people live in poverty in the UK – that’s 1 in 5 of population.

3.8 million children in the UK are living in poverty.

2.2 million pensioners in the UK are living in poverty.

7.2 million working age adults in the UK are living in poverty.

70% of Bangladeshi children in the UK are poor.

Women are the majority in the poorest groups.

London has a higher proportion of people living in poverty than any other region in the UK

The UK has a higher proportion of its population living in relative poverty than most other EU countries: of the 27 EU countries, only 6 have a higher rate than the UK.
